Bell County Man Faces Multiple Child Abuse Charges

A man previously arrested in Harlan County in August is back in custody following a recent indictment by a Bell County Grand Jury.

According to the Bell County Sheriff’s Department, the investigation leading to the indictment of 44-year-old Christopher Shipman, of Cumberland, Kentucky, was conducted by Sgt. Jody Risner and Detective Hunter Luttrell.

Shipman was originally taken into custody on August 21, 2025, with assistance from multiple law enforcement agencies.

On Monday night, November 17th, Shipman was served an indictment warrant in Harlan County. Assistance was provided by the Evarts Police Department, Harlan Police Department, and the Harlan County Sheriff’s Department.

Shipman has been indicted on the following charges:

  • Two counts of Sodomy, 1st Degree – Victim Under 12

  • Two counts of Sexual Abuse, 1st Degree – Victim Under 12

  • Strangulation, 1st Degree

He is currently lodged in the Bell County Detention Center.

The Bell County Sheriff’s Department reports that additional charges are pending as the investigation continues.

UPDATE! 11-19-25
BELL COUNTY, Ky. — The Bell County Sheriff’s Department has issued an update in a disturbing and graphic case involving the death of an unborn child.

On Tuesday, November 18, 2025, Detective Hunter Luttrell filed an additional charge of Fetal Homicide against Christopher Shipman.

According to investigators, the charge stems from an incident that occurred on or around October 28, 2019. Detectives allege that Shipman intentionally caused the death of an unborn child belonging to a female victim who was approximately 14 weeks pregnant at the time.

Deputy Luttrell reports that Shipman is accused of repeatedly punching and kicking the victim in the stomach, causing severe pain that resulted in the loss of the pregnancy on the floor of the residence. The incident reportedly occurred in the presence of the victim’s 5-year-old child.

Shipman is further accused of disposing of the remains in a toilet following the assault.

The investigation remains ongoing, and no additional details have been released at this time.
